The Amethyst Mosaic Edo Kiriko Whiskey Glass is a sophisticated crystal tumbler defined by its luminous violet tone, intricate hand-cut detailing, and richly layered geometric structure.
The upper section is covered with a dense lattice of fine starburst cuts that shimmer beautifully under light, giving the glass a delicate and highly refined surface texture. At the center, a bold amethyst band is framed by mosaic-like faceted cuts that create depth, symmetry, and a jewel-like visual rhythm. The lower section transitions into clear crystal facets that add clarity, brilliance, and a balanced sense of weight.
With a 10.1 fl oz capacity and a substantial 11.7 oz weight, this tumbler feels solid and premium in the hand. It is ideal for whiskey, bourbon, cocktails, or as a collectible statement piece for a refined home bar. The combination of clear crystal, violet color, and precise cutwork makes it especially suitable for display and gifting.
Each glass is individually hand-cut, so slight variations may appear between pieces. These subtle differences are part of the character of handcrafted crystal glass and make every piece unique.
Each pattern is drawn by hand, mapping how light will travel through every facet.
Diamond wheels carve the primary facets. One wrong angle and the piece is lost.
Each facet is refined by hand. Depth, edge, angle - adjusted until geometry becomes art.
Progressive abrasives bring out optical clarity. Light passes through without distortion.
